Daimler delivers first Freightliner electric commercial truck to Penske
Daimler Trucks North America has delivered the first vehicle in its Freightliner Electric Innovation Fleet – a Freightliner eM2 – to Penske Truck Leasing. Next year, Penske will put an additional 9 medium-duty electric eM2 trucks and 10 heavy-duty eCascadia electric trucks into service in California and the Pacific Northwest. Bullish on batteries, Daimler to invest more than $23 billion in battery cells by 2030
To support its goal of electrifying the entire Mercedes portfolio by 2022, Daimler plans to invest more than €20 billion ($23 billion) in battery cells by 2030.
